Council warns claims of β23% funding increaseβ are misleading as government shifts burden onto council tax - News
Devon County Council has warned that claims of a β23% increaseβ in funding for Devon are inaccurate and highly misleading, following the Governmentβs
Devon County Council has responded to the provisional local government finance settlement, cautioning that headline claims of a β23% increaseβ in funding are misleading. Noting that Core Spending Power includes assumed council tax rises rather than representing new government funding.

Early analysis of the Provisional Settlement suggests ongoing disparities:
β’ Urban councils could receive 41% more Gov funded spending power per head
β’ Rural residents projected to pay 20% more in council tax
β’ Funding growth: 21% urban vs 1% rural

Local government finance policy statement 2026-27 to 2028-29
ββThe local government finance policy statement sets out governmentβs proposals for the 2026-27 to 2028-29 multi-year Local Government Finance Settlement.
Weβre disappointed that todayβs policy statement fails to apply the remoteness adjustment across all services. Distance & sparsity clearly increase the cost of delivering local services in rural areas. Weβll share more once weβve examined the detail.
